Last affected by July 1st Hurricane Beryl passes 45 miles to the north while moving WNW with 130mph winds.
This areas hurricane past 1878 Sept 1st a hurricane passes just S.W by 27 miles with 85mph winds from the S.E
1892 Oct 6th a tropical storm becomes a hurricane while passing over with 75mph winds from the east.
1963 Sept 30th Hurricane Flora pummels the area directly with 125mph winds from the ESE.
